Contract Maintenance Manager

CBRE Government & Defense ServicesFt. Campbell, KY
Onsite

About The Position

Position provides oversight, direction and coordination for all operations and maintenance (O and M) activities at assigned jobsite to ensure adherence to contractual objectives. Position supervises and coordinates activities of skilled trades workers engaged in maintaining and repairing equipment, structures, utility systems, buildings, and grounds at assigned jobsite. This position is a full-time position and is required to assist in emergencies relating to the operation and repair of clinic equipment and may need to respond to calls 24/7. The selected applicant’s résumé must be reviewed and approved by the Contracting Officer (KO) before an offer of employment may be extended.

Requirements

  • 5 years in bedded inpatient healthcare maintenance and operations.
  • 5 years TJC experience
  • Must possess a current Certified Healthcare Facility Manager (CHFM) certification.
  • Must have minimum five (5) years of experience in comparable facility operations and maintenance, including the supervision of a diversified work force responsible for 24-hour (24/7/365) operations, maintenance and repair of comparable facility systems.
  • Must have formal training related to the Life Safety Code standards.
  • Must have working experience with EPA, OSHA codes and standards.
  • Must have 5-years’ experience with compliance documentation for O&M operations such as DMLSS and DMLSS work requests and all supporting testing, certification, and verification documentation either with in-house and/or subcontracted personnel.
  • Must be able to read, write, speak, and understand English.
  • Safety Personnel Qualifications.
  • Experienced with computer programs including all applications of Microsoft Suite, CMMS & BAS.
  • Demonstrated capability to work in a dynamic, fast paced environment; action oriented and able to handle multiple priorities at a time.
  • Effective oral and written communications skills; ability to read and understand blueprints.

Responsibilities

  • Perform Operations & Maintenance Management administration functions, handling a variety of actions and problems relating to assigned contract(s).
  • Monitor management plans designed to accomplish contractual objectives and provide direction and support to subcontractors, support staff, trades and crafts.
  • Responsible for scheduling of work to be performed.
  • Responsible for submitting various monthly progress reports in accordance with contract and Company requirements
  • Manages and commits contract resources; monitors budgets on assigned contracts.
  • Responsible for safety of all personnel on job, including sub-contractor personnel, compliance with environment standards and quality of work performed.
  • Conducts training of staff, as well as safety meetings and briefings.
  • Research and address customer and employee complaints.
  • Perform over the shoulder inspections and help maintain a safe work environment.
  • The Contract Maintenance Manager shall be on site during the Government’s regular working hours.
  • Additional duties as required.
